180 credits at FHEQ level 7. M-Level programme of study. The FHEQ 7 qualification must have a significant research element.
Extra Requirements
All short-listed candidates must be interviewed.
RPL
The following criteria are essential: M-Level programme study.
Applicants will be required to make a claim for accreditation of prior learning; consideration of any such claim will be undertaken by the University Recognition Group in line with the requirements of the University's Academic Framework.
